Work In Its Place

Fairfox welcomes digital nomads.

High-speed internet and dedicated workspaces make remote work possible, but work is not the center of life here.

We are not built around work.
We fit work into life.

To preserve a social and creative atmosphere, phones and laptops are used only in designated areas. Many gatherings remain intentionally digital-free.

The Grounds

The space allows for both gathering and retreat.

Fire pits, outdoor kitchens, and shaded platforms create places for conversation and music.
Water access and sauna offer space for rest.

There are also simple landing spaces for van travelers and seasonal accommodations.
